Output 18651f1eb279651b11989b7000f8c8d89e276e1a585ba8c935849e51f873cfb7:1

value
3871594425
script pubkey
OP_0 OP_PUSHBYTES_20 6eb266dbfadc97648ceb0ff77a10189cab3067ad
address
tb1qd6exdkl6mjtkfr8tplmh5yqcnj4nqeadxjkpdh
transaction
18651f1eb279651b11989b7000f8c8d89e276e1a585ba8c935849e51f873cfb7
confirmations
106000
spent
true